Gaps in Cybersecurity Programs

War at Home: How U.S. Corporations are on the Front Lines of the Silent War on Privacy

Jarrett Kolthoff
May 1, 2020
The four individuals who were identified and indicted by the Trump Administration in relation to the Equifax breach from 2017 is yet another example of the overt collection efforts by the Chinese government to steal Americans’ sensitive personal information. The openness of the U.S. government to share these examples should help bring the reality of cyber threats to the forefront in corporate board rooms and research universities. I would like to highlight that these particular attacks were conducted for a different goal – espionage.

Chinese Military Hackers Charged in Equifax Breach

February 10, 2020
A federal grand jury in Atlanta, Ga. returned an indictment last week charging four members of the Chinese People’s Liberation Army (PLA) with hacking into the computer systems of the credit reporting agency Equifax and stealing Americans’ personal data and Equifax’s valuable trade secrets.

Equifax Settles 2017 Data Breach for $1.38 Billion

January 20, 2020
A class action settlement has been proposed in a case against Equifax Inc., relating to the data breach that Equifax announced in September 2017, which affected approximately 147 million U.S. consumers.

Equifax to Pay $700M for 2017 Data Breach

July 22, 2019

Equifax will pay a $700 million settlement over a 2017 data breach that exposed Social Security numbers and other data of nearly 150 million people.
